Lalbaugcha Raja Ratnakar Kambli (The pinnacle on the Kambli family members) was a sculptor of idols and experienced roaming exhibitions at festivals across Maharashtra. He commenced safeguarding the idol in 1935, when some of his good friends advised his name on the organisers. Following his demise in 1952, his eldest son Venkatesh took about and, right after his Dying, Ratnakar Kambli Jr.

The Ganesh Chaturthi revelry that characterises Mumbai throughout this time of your year, in fact commenced in the resolution of a sustained duration of hardship. Given that the lore goes, Bappa arrived towards the rescue. The Lalbaug spot in town, again in the 1900s, comprised of about a 100 textile mills which started to growth with the 1930s. This nevertheless, had a adverse influence on the lives in the locals there.
